Fender American Deluxe Precision with BEAD tuning

Sign in to disble this ad
Hey y'all! I'm looking to purchase for myself a new American Deluxe Precision bass. I wanted to get a five string model but they stopped when they came out with the new model in 2010.

So I'm looking at the new model and wondering if I can set it up with BEAD tuning using the correct gauged strings. I'm concerned with the string retainer on the A string. Will an E string gauged at 105 fit in the retainer and will it affect the E string in a bad way? Can it be removed easily if it does not work with the E string?

Also I have read from a few people on here that Fender P-basses do not play well with a B string. Can anyone else share their experience with this as well. Maybe that's the reason why Fender stopped making the American deluxe five string...

Any help is a appreciated! Thanks!
